Vietnamese law on sanctions for violations of delivery obligations causing damage to business profits of enterprises
O artigo estuda e esclarece a perda de lucros intencionalmente causada por empresas que violam a obrigação de entrega na relação contratual de compra e venda de bens. O objetivo dessa violação é se beneficiar das flutuações de preços no mercado. A pesquisa no artigo também determina o nível de perda de acordo com o valor de mercado e aplica as disposições da Lei Comercial do Vietnã sobre a compra e venda de bens e regulamentações relacionadas, sanções para empresas que causam intencionalmente perdas a empresas parceiras na forma de compensação integral por perdas, remediando as consequências The article studies and clarifies the loss of profits intentionally caused by enterprises violating the delivery obligation in the contract relationship of goods purchase and sale. The purpose of this violation is to benefit from price fluctuations in the market. The research in the article also determines the level of loss according to the market value and applies the provisions of the Commercial Law of Vietnam on the purchase and sale of goods and related regulations, sanctions for enterprises intentionally causing losses to partner enterprises in the form of full compensation for losses, remedying the consequences.  
Perda de valor real das indenizações por dano moral por abalo ao crédito em sentenças de primeiro grau no TJSP
Resumo O artigo apresenta uma pesquisa empírica sobre a oscilação das indenizações por danos morais ao longo do tempo em ações que discutem negativação ou protesto indevido. A pesquisa investigou se os valores das indenizações por danos morais nas sentenças dos últimos anos foram aumentados para acompanhar a inflação. Foi adotado o método quantitativo, com a coleta de sentenças de primeiro grau proferidas pelo Tribunal de Justiça de São Paulo (TJSP) entre 2014 e 2023. Utilizou-se mineração de texto (text mining) com Large Language Model (LLM) para identificar as sentenças que condenaram ao pagamento de indenização por danos morais e, em caso positivo, o valor da condenação. Os dados obtidos foram analisados por meio de ferramentas estatísticas. A média das condenações em cada ano foi comparada à variação do Índice Nacional de Preços ao Consumidor Amplo (IPCA), do salário mínimo e do Índice Geral de Preços - Mercado (IGP-M). Os resultados demonstraram que a média das indenizações sofreu pouca variação, não acompanhando a inflação. Apresentou-se como hipótese explicativa a ausência de ajuste pela inflação sobre a âncora usada nas sentenças, que seriam os valores das indenizações adotados pelo mesmo juiz em casos anteriores. Concluiu-se que as indenizações, nas sentenças de primeiro grau do TJSP, vêm perdendo valor real, recomendando-se a adoção de algum mecanismo de ajuste periódico. Abstract This article presents an empirical study on the fluctuation of moral damage awards over time, in lawsuits concerning wrongful credit reporting or undue protest. The research investigated whether the amounts of moral damage awards in recent years’ rulings have increased to keep pace with inflation. It was used the quantitative method, with the collection of first-instance judgments issued by the São Paulo Court of Justice (TJSP) between 2014 and 2023. Text mining techniques with a Large Language Model (LLM) were used to identify the judgments that ruled in favor of awarding compensation for moral damages and, if so, the amount of the award. The data were analyzed using statistical tools. The judgments’ average in each year was compared to the variation of the IPCA (Brazil’s official inflation index, based on what families buy), the minimum wage (the lowest legal salary a worker can receive in Brazil, set by the government) and the IGP-M (Brazilian inflation index often used to adjust rents and contracts). The results demonstrated that the average of the compensations changed little, not keeping up with inflation. The lack of inflation adjustment on the anchor adopted in the sentences-which would be the values of compensations used by the same judge in previous cases-was presented as an explanatory hypothesis. It was concluded that the compensations of first-instance decisions at TJSP are losing real value, recommending the use of some mechanism of periodic adjustment. Metals as a cause of oxidative stress in fish: a review
This review summarizes the current knowledge on the contribution of metals to the development of oxidative stress in fish. Metals are important inducers of oxidative stress in aquatic organisms, promoting formation of reactive oxygen species through two mechanisms. Redox active metals generate reactive oxygen species through redox cycling, while metals without redox potential impair antioxidant defences, especially that of thiol-containing antioxidants and enzymes. Elevated levels of reactive oxygen species lead to oxidative damage including lipid peroxidation, protein and DNA oxidation, and enzyme inactivation. Antioxidant defences include the enzyme system and low molecular weight antioxidants. Metal-binding proteins, such as ferritin, ceruloplasmin and metallothioneins, have special functions in the detoxification of toxic metals and also play a role in the metabolism and homeostasis of essential metals. Recent studies of metallothioneins as biomarkers indicate that quantitative analysis of mRNA expression of metallothionein genes can be appropriate in cases with elevated levels of metals and no evidence of oxidative damage in fish tissue. Components of the antioxidant defence are used as biochemical markers of oxidative stress. These markers may be manifested differently in the field than in results found in laboratory studies. A complex approach should be taken in field studies of metal contamination of the aquatic environment.
Data-driven predictive performance models for pandemic forecasting: systematic review protocol / Modelos de performance preditiva orientados por dados para previsão de pandemias: protocolo de revisão sistemática
Objetivo: analisar os modelos e as métricas de performance preditiva orientada por dados desenvolvidas, validadas ou implementadas para previsão de pandemias em populações humanas. Métodos: protocolo de revisão sistemática, fundamentado no Preferred Reporting Items for Systematic Reviews and Meta-Analyses. A busca e seleção ocorrerão em sete base de dados. Serão incluídos estudos que apresentem modelos e métricas temporais capazes de prever pandemias. Dois revisores conduzirão o processo de elegibilidade. A qualidade metodológica será estimada pelo JBI Critical Appraisal Checklist for Studies. Ferramentas de gerenciamento e análise avançada de dados serão utilizados. Resultados: espera-se conhecer os modelos desenvolvidos e analisar suas métricas de desempenho como acurácia, sensibilidade e especificidade. Ainda, identificar padrões, tendências e lacunas que devem ser superadas. Considerações finais: as implicações podem abranger dimensões assistenciais, gerenciais, políticas, sociais e econômicas ao apoiar a tomada de decisão e subsidiar políticas públicas que geram respostas rápidas na previsão de emergências sanitárias.
Expression of Insl3 Protein in Adult Danio rerio
Insulin-like peptide 3 (INSL3) is a biomarker for Leydig cells in the testes of vertebrates, and it is principally involved in spermatogenesis through specific binding with the RXFP2 receptor. This study reports the insl3 gene transcript and the Insl3 prepropeptide expression in both non-reproductive and reproductive tissues of Danio rerio. An immunohistochemistry analysis shows that the hormone is present at a low level in the Leydig cells and germ cells at all stages of Danio rerio testis differentiation. Considering that the insl3 gene is transcribed in Leydig cells, our results highlight an autocrine and paracrine function of this hormone in the Danio rerio testis, adding new information on the Insl3 mode of action in reproduction. We also show that Insl3 and Rxfp2 belonging to Danio rerio and other vertebrate species share most of the amino acid residues involved in the ligand–receptor interaction and activation, suggesting a conserved mechanism of action during vertebrate evolution.
Terbium-based dual-ligand metal organic framework by diffusion method for selective and sensitive detection of danofloxacin in aqueous medium
A water-dispersible Tb(III)-based metal organic framework (TBP) was produced by diffusion technique using benzene-1,3,5-tricarboxylic acid (BTC) and pyridine as easily accessible ligands at low cost. The as-synthesized TBP with a crystalline structure and rod-shaped morphology has exhibited thermal stability up to 465 °C. Elemental analysis confirmed the presence of carbon, oxygen, nitrogen, and terbium in the synthesized MOF. TBP was used as a fluorescent probe for detection of danofloxacin (DANO) in an aqueous medium with significant enhancement of fluorescence intensity as compared to various fluoroquinolone antibiotics (levofloxacin (LEVO), ofloxacin (OFLO), norfloxacin (NOR), and ciprofloxacin (CIPRO)) with a low detection limit of 0.45 ng/mL (1.25 nm). The developed method has successfully detected DANO rapidly (i.e., response time = 1 min) with remarkable recovery (97.66–101.96%) and a relative standard deviation (RSD) of less than 2.2%. Additionally, TBP showcased good reusability up to three cycles without any significant performance decline. The in-depth mechanistic studies of the density functional theory (DFT) calculations and mode of action revealed that hydrogen bonding interactions and photo-induced electron transfer (PET) are the major factors for the turn-on enhancement behavior of TBP towards DANO. Thus, the present work provides the quick and precise identification of DANO using a new fluorescent MOF (TBP) synthesized via a unique and facile diffusion technique. Graphical Abstract
Evolution of the physical and physiological quality of soybean seeds during processing
Seed processing or conditioning is important for improving soybean seed lot quality as it improves the physical characteristics by eliminating inert materials, weed and non-standard seeds and increases physiological quality. The objective of this study was to evaluate the effect of processing on physical and physiological qualities of soybean seed, before and after each equipment and transport system, during processing in a Seed Processing Plant. Samples of six cultivars were obtained during processing while seeds passed through each machine, totaling fifteen sampling sites. The experimental design was entirely randomized, treatments arranged in 15 x 6 factorial scheme, with 10 replications. Characteristics evaluated were germination; vigor by accelerated aging test; tetrazolium test for viability (TZ 1 to 5), vigor (TZ 1 to 3), weathering damage (TZ 3), mechanical damages (TZ 2 to 8), stinkbug damages (TZ 2 to 8) and moisture content. Results showed that processing improves the physiological and physical qualities of soybean seeds and enhances average quality seeds. The equipment and the system of transport (lifts and conveyor belts) used in this study did not cause mechanical damages to the seeds; the mechanical damages were mostly detected in larger seeds and stinkbug damages were found in smaller seeds; and seeds with weathering damage were neither eliminated nor reduced by any processing line. Resumo: O beneficiamento de sementes tem uma importância fundamental na melhoria da qualidade de lotes de sementes de soja, podendo melhorar as caracacterísticas físicas pela eliminação de materiais inertes, sementes de plantas daninhas e sementes fora de padrão e permitindo incremento na qualidade fisiológica. Objetivou-se com este trabalho avaliar a evolução das características físicas e fisiológicas das sementes de soja ao longo da linha de beneficiamento, sendo avaliadas seis cultivares em quinze pontos de amostragem. Delineou-se em DIC, em fatorial 15 x 6 e 10 repetições. Avaliou-se germinação; vigor no envelhecimento acelerado; viabilidade pelo teste de tetrazólio (TZ classes 1 a 5); vigor (TZ classes 1 a 3); deterioração por umidade (TZ classe 3); danos mecânicos totais (TZ classes 2 a 8); danos por percevejos (TZ classes 2 a 8); e grau de umidade. Concluiu-se que o beneficiamento melhora as qualidades física e fisiológica das sementes, sendo a eficiência acentuada nas sementes de qualidade mediana. O sistema de transporte (elevadores e correias transportadoras) não promoveu danos mecânicos às sementes. As sementes maiores tendem a ser mais afetadas pelos danos mecânicos, e menores apresentam mais danos por percevejos. As sementes deterioradas por umidade não são eliminadas em nenhuma etapa do beneficiamento.
Redução de danos e vínculos com usuários de drogas: a escuta do olhar de um palhaço
The present work is the result of a dissertation carried out in the Graduate Program in Psychology at the Federal University of Uberlândia. The study aimed to raise insights on the experiences of the researcher as he played the role of a clown/damage reducer while taking part in the Street Office team. The effort integrated the Public Health Network of a city in the countryside of Minas Gerais State, Brazil. The method consisted of mapping the possible therapeutic effects of this way of working with homeless people: on the street, stimulating bonds through daily basis encounters lived in the territory. The effects of this investigative and interventional experience led us to recognize the importance of respect toward drug users and the uniqueness of each occupied territory; from the open-hearted welcoming to individuals to the construction of bonds in order to set the conditions for the collective problematization of the drug use issue. Such actions were based on knowledge, practices, and achievements of the anti-asylum struggle, contextualized by conflicts between the institutionalized war on drugs, as well as treatments based on total abstinence. In contrast, harm reduction presents an insight on the right for freedom and flexible regulations on drug use, which may expand therapeutic possibilities. EARTHQUAKE-INDUCED BUILDING DETECTION BASED ON OBJECT-LEVEL TEXTURE FEATURE CHANGE DETECTION OF MULTI-TEMPORAL SAR IMAGES
The damage of buildings is the major cause of casualties of from earthquakes. The traditional pixel-based earthquake damaged building detection method is prone to be affected by speckle noise. In this paper, an object-based change detection method is presented for the detection of earthquake damage using the synthetic aperture radar (SAR) data. The method is based on object-level texture features of SAR data. Firstly, the principal component analysis is used to transform the optimal texture features into a suitable feature space for extracting the key change. And then, the feature space is clustered by the watershed segmentation algorithm, which introduces the concept of object orientation and carries out the calculation of the difference map at the object level. Having training samples, the classification threshold values for different grade of earthquake damage can be trained, and the detection of damaged building is achieved. The proposed method could visualize the earthquake damage efficiently using the Advanced Land Observing Satellite-1 (ALOS-1) images. Its performance is evaluated in the town of jiegu, which was hit severely by the Yushu Earthquake. The cross-validation results shows that the overall accuracy is significantly higher than TDCD and IDCD.
